Analysis of Musculoskeletal Systems and Their Diseases. Regulation of chondrogenesis and cartilage regeneration by molecular and developmental biology

2015 
: In decades, the signaling pathways that regulate chondrogenesis and the differentiation of chondrocytes have been identified. Molecular biological understanding of the commitment of mesenchymal cells to the chondrogenic lineage, which leads to endochondral bone formation, is necessary to understand pathophysiology of bone/cartilage metabolic diseases and cartilage degenerative diseases. In this review, we show how multiple growth factors and signaling molecules are integrated to activate a series of transcription factors in connection with morphological cell features, which regulates chondrogenesis and chondrocyte differentiation.
